#2f2633 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f2633 is composed of 18.4% red, 14.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 14.6% and a lightness of 17.5%. #2f2633 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e4c66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2f2633 color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#2f2633 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f2633 has RGB values of R:47, G:38,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3089971.

Shades and Tints of #2f2633
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060406 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f2633
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2930 is the less saturated color, while #3d0059 is the most saturated one.
